About the role

Role:
We need someone to coordinate and manage our Making Sense of Money project to work with learners and partners to deliver workshops and focus on issues involving money management. As well as being able to signpost the public to advice and information

Specific requirements
  • Experience delivering workshops to a wide audience with a particular focus on budgeting, managing money and avoiding getting into debt
  • Managing own work load and reporting on projects and representing us at a range of community events
